Summer STEAM Camp Sampler 2

Each day will feature opportunities for campers to dive into all the things the Fab Lab is known for: coding robots, solving engineering challenges, and so much more! Campers will have lots of choice as to where they spend their time- they could spend all their time with robots, all their time with Legos, or they could dive into 3D design with Tinkercad. Campers will be grouped by age and will be engaged in age-appropriate, engaging and fun activities throughout the day.

Come explore all things STEAM (Science Technology Engineering Arts Math) and Fab Lab to kick off your summer!

 


Kids will also have fun with Open Fab Lab time (where kids choose different activity stations), team-building activities, movement breaks, time for both independent and group exploration, and general STEAM challenges.
